Understanding the Role of AI in Roller Mills

1. Enhanced Process Optimization

AI technologies enable real-time monitoring and adjustment of roller mills, leading to improved efficiency and productivity.

  • Implementation: Utilize AI-driven sensors to collect data on mill performance, such as pressure, speed, and temperature.
  • Benefit: This data allows for immediate adjustments, ensuring optimal milling conditions.
  • Scenario: A pharmaceutical company can prevent production delays by addressing issues as they arise, maintaining a consistent throughput.

2. Predictive Maintenance

Utilizing AI for predictive maintenance can significantly reduce operational downtimes associated with roller mills.

  • Implementation: Deploy machine learning algorithms to analyze historical data and predict equipment failures.
  • Benefit: Predictive maintenance helps avert unscheduled downtime by addressing potential issues before they escalate.
  • Scenario: A facility can schedule maintenance during planned downtimes, minimizing disruption to production schedules.

3. Quality Control Automation

AI can automate quality control processes, ensuring that the end product meets stringent pharmaceutical standards.

  • Implementation: Integrate AI image recognition systems to inspect API particles for size and uniformity.
  • Benefit: Automated quality checks provide consistency and reduce human errors.
  • Scenario: A quality assurance team can focus on more complex inspections, knowing that basic quality checks are handled automatically.

4. Data-Driven Decision Making

With AI's ability to analyze vast amounts of data, pharmaceutical companies can make better-informed decisions regarding roller mill operations.

  • Implementation: Use AI analytics platforms to analyze production data for trends and insights.
  • Benefit: Managers can optimize resource allocation and manufacturing processes based on solid data.
  • Scenario: If certain milling parameters consistently lead to better product yield, companies can standardize those conditions across all batches.

5. Improved Safety Protocols

AI enhances safety by monitoring machinery and personnel in real-time, alerting for any potential hazards.

  • Implementation: The deployment of AI-powered surveillance systems to monitor the operational environment.
  • Benefit: Continuous monitoring reduces risks related to equipment malfunctions and operator errors.
  • Scenario: An alert system can notify operators immediately if something goes awry, preventing accidents and ensuring worker safety.
